Bitung is a city located in North Sulawesi province, Indonesia. Situated on the northeastern coast of the Minahasa Peninsula, Bitung serves as a major port city facing the Molucca Sea and Lembeh Strait. With an approximate population of around 200,000 people, Bitung covers an area of approximately 304 square kilometers, making it one of the most important urban centers in North Sulawesi. The city is administratively divided into 8 districts (kecamatan) and 69 villages (kelurahan), reflecting its significant urban development and population density. Bitung's strategic coastal location has established it as a crucial economic hub, particularly known for its deep-water port that serves as a major gateway for trade and transportation in eastern Indonesia. The city's economy is heavily dependent on its port activities, fishing industry, and processing of agricultural products from the surrounding region. Bitung is also recognized for its proximity to the biodiverse Lembeh Strait, famous among marine biologists and divers for its exceptional marine life.
